Goal setting as motivation

 Setting goals is the biggest motivator. Students write their goals down in MYMAHI. At the end of the year, most students who wrote down their goals achieve them. Students who did't write them down didn't achieve. SIMPLE. Write down your goals. Then ask WHY? What will change if you achieve your goals? This is the fuel that make you chase and complete your goals Constant remind  yourself end review the goals. Write them on the board, Put them on your wallet and screensaver,,on your mirror so every morning the first thing you doo is see your goals. Have a plan to achieve your goals.This is the roadmap and have deadlines. Look for resources that will help you achieve your goals. Rewards yourself afterwards and set new, higher goals. SMARTER goals S PECIFIC M EASURE A TTANIABLE R EALISTIC T IME E XTEND R EWARD
